它以强大的功能、灵活性和广泛的兼容性,成为了无数IT专业人士的首选
然而,即便是如此成熟且广泛应用的软件,在安装过程中也可能会遇到各种挑战,其中报错代码1721便是许多用户频繁遭遇的难题之一
本文将深入探讨VMware安装报错1721的根源、常见表现形式、以及一系列高效实用的解决方案,旨在帮助用户顺利跨越这一障碍,享受虚拟化带来的便捷与高效
一、报错1721概述 报错代码1721,通常出现在VMware Workstation、VMware Fusion或VMware ESXi等产品的安装过程中
这个错误通常与Windows Installer服务相关,具体表现为安装程序无法正确访问或修改必要的安装文件,从而导致安装失败
错误消息可能会以多种形式呈现,但核心提示往往围绕着“Windows Installer 包有问题
此安装需要的 DLL 无法运行
错误代码 1721”,或直接显示“安装程序无法安装必要的文件
错误代码 1721”
二、报错原因分析 1.Windows Installer服务异常:Windows Installer服务是Windows操作系统中负责安装、修改和删除软件程序的核心组件
如果该服务被禁用、损坏或运行不正常,就会引发安装过程中的错误
2.注册表问题:注册表中关于Windows Installer的条目可能因软件卸载不当、系统更新失败等原因而变得混乱,影响安装程序的正常运行
3.权限不足:尝试安装VMware的用户可能没有足够的权限来访问或修改必要的系统文件和注册表项,尤其是在企业环境或受限用户账户下
4.文件损坏:下载的VMware安装包可能因网络问题、存储介质故障等原因而损坏,导致安装文件不完整
5.安全软件干扰:防火墙、杀毒软件等安全软件有时会错误地将安装程序或其组件视为威胁,从而阻止其正常执行
三、实战解决方案 针对上述原因,以下提供了一系列针对性的解决步骤,旨在帮助用户逐一排查并解决问题
1. 检查并重启Windows Installer服务 步骤: 1. 按`Win + R`键打开运行对话框,输入`services.msc`并按回车
2. 在服务列表中找到“Windows Installer”服务,检查其状态是否为“正在运行”
3. 如果服务未运行,右键点击选择“启动”
若服务已启动但仍出现问题,尝试右键点击选择“重新启动”
4. 确认服务状态正常后,重新运行VMware安装程序
2. 清理和修复注册表 - 警告:直接编辑注册表存在风险,可能导致系统不稳定或无法启动
建议在操作前备份注册表
步骤: 1. 使用`regedit`命令打开注册表编辑器
2. 导航至`HKEY_LOCAL_MACHINESOFTWAREMicrosoftWindowsCurrentVersionInstaller`路径,检查是否有异常或损坏的条目
3. 考虑使用第三方注册表清理工具(如CCleaner)进行扫描和修复,但需谨慎操作
3. 以管理员权限运行安装程序 步骤: 1. 右击VMware安装程序图标,选择“以管理员身份运行”
2. 根据安装向导完成安装过程
4. 验证安装包完整性 步骤: 1. 重新从官方渠道下载VMware安装包
2. 使用MD5或SHA-256校验和工具验证下载文件的完整性,确保与官方网站提供的校验和值一致
3. 使用新的安装包进行安装
5. 临时禁用安全软件 步骤: 1. 暂时禁用防火墙和杀毒软件
2. 运行VMware安装程序
3. 安装完成后,记得重新启用安全软件,并确保VMware被添加到信任列表中
6. 系统还原或重置 - 系统还原:如果问题出现在最近的系统更新或软件安装之后,可以尝试使用系统还原功能回到之前的状态
- 重置Windows:对于严重受损的系统,考虑执行重置操作,但请注意这将删除所有个人文件和应用程序,需谨慎操作
四、预防措施 为了避免未来再次遇到类似问题,建议采取以下预防措施: - 定期更新系统:确保Windows操作系统及其所有关键组件(包括Windows Installer服务)都是最新版本
- 使用官方渠道下载:始终从VMware官方网站下载安装包,避免使用非官方或来源不明的版本
- 备份重要数据:定期备份注册表、系统文件和重要数据,以防不测
- 谨慎安装第三方软件:避免安装来源不明的软件,以减少对系统稳定性的影响
- 监控安全软件行为:了解并合理配置防火墙和杀毒软件,避免它们误报或阻止合法软件的安装
五、结语 VMware安装报错1721虽然看似复杂,但通过系统性的排查和针对性的解决策略,绝大多数用户都能成功克服这一挑战
本文提供的解决方案覆盖了从基础服务检查到高级系统维护的多个层面,旨在为用户提供一套全面而实用的指南
记住,耐心和细致是解决问题的关键
在尝试上述方法时,不妨一步步来,每解决一个小问题,就离成功更近一步
希望每位遇到VMware安装报错1721的用户都能顺利找到适合自己的解决方案,享受虚拟化技术带来的无限可能